随笔分类 -  shell

one language ,one world
shell书写换行 便于阅读 转载
摘要:shell 书写时如何便于阅读,长句变短句用 \ ;如果要加注释,需要用`# `引上,并且要在\之前 阅读全文
posted @ 2020-10-25 10:27 时迅 阅读(1314) 评论(0) 推荐(0)
bc let
摘要:1、错误方法举例 a) var=1+1 echo $var 输出的结果是1+1,悲剧,呵呵 b) var=1 var=$var+1 echo $var 输出结果是1+1,依然悲剧,呵呵 2、正确方法 1)使用let var=1 let "var+=1" echo $var 输出结果为2,这次没有悲剧 阅读全文
posted @ 2017-08-03 18:59 时迅 阅读(114) 评论(0) 推荐(0)
shell 循环
摘要:关于shell中的for循环用法很多,一直想总结一下,今天网上看到上一篇关于for循环用法的总结,感觉很全面,所以就转过来研究研究,嘿嘿...1、 for((i=1;i<=10;i++));do echo $(expr $i \* 4);done2、在shell中常用的是 for i in $(se 阅读全文
posted @ 2017-04-07 14:14 时迅 阅读(217) 评论(0) 推荐(0)
shell if 浮点数比较
摘要:转shell中的浮点数比较http://nigelzeng.iteye.com/blog/1604640 博客分类: Bash Shell shell比较浮点数 由于程序需要,我要判断一个浮点数是否大于另一个浮点数。 大概情况描述如下: 变量 mya的值为一个两位小数,这个值是这么取的: Shell 阅读全文
posted @ 2016-12-14 15:51 时迅 阅读(14417) 评论(0) 推荐(0)
shell 计算2
摘要:转载 http://www.th7.cn/system/lin/201309/44683.shtml expr bc 在Linux下做算术运算时你是如何进行的呢?是不是还在用expr呢?你会说我还会bc还有其它的呢! 闲话不多扯,干正事! expr expr在使用中要注意一些书写,如表达式中量和运算 阅读全文
posted @ 2016-12-11 15:46 时迅 阅读(212) 评论(0) 推荐(0)
写入文件
摘要:> 先清空,再写入 >> 直接写入 阅读全文
posted @ 2016-12-10 16:15 时迅 阅读(133) 评论(0) 推荐(0)
shell if
摘要:转载 http://blog.sina.com.cn/s/blog_691f18960101jbj1.html 诡异的语法 一般 bash 教程给出的语法示例基本就是: 看起来很简单,除了 condition 外(也就是条件部分),其余关键字都没什么难懂了,顶多注意一下写在同一行要加分号。 但条件部 阅读全文
posted @ 2016-12-09 21:29 时迅 阅读(249) 评论(0) 推荐(0)
shell 计算
摘要:1、整数计算 输出 2(注意必须是两个括号) 注意这里不支持括号,a%b,a/b后取余 output: 1 2、小数计算 1 bc <<< 'scale=4;20+5/2' 输出22.5000 output: 8.33333 output:1.2 3、三角函数等特殊计算 阅读全文
posted @ 2016-12-08 21:06 时迅 阅读(173) 评论(0) 推荐(0)